High-Throughput Investigation of Polymerization Kinetics by Online Monitoring of GPC and GC

- Abstract:
- Gel permeation chromatography (GPC) and gas
chromatography (GC) were successfully introduced into a
high-throughput workflow. The feasibility and limitations of
online GPC with a high-speed column was evaluated by
measuring polystyrene standards and comparison of the results
with regular offline GPC measurements. The reliability
of the online GC characterization was investigated by monitoring
the cationic ring-opening-polymerization of 2-ethyl-2-
oxazoline, whose polymerization kinetics were determined
by both online and offline GC.
